WASHINGTON, April 22 -- Sen. Peter Welch issued the following press release:
Today, U.S. Senators Peter Welch (D-Vt.) and Marsha Blackburn (R-Tenn.), members of the Senate Judiciary Subcommittee on Intellectual Property, held a roundtable on Capitol Hill with more than 20 artists to discuss the Senators' bipartisan TRAIN Act (https://www.welch.senate.gov/welch-leads-bipartisan-bill-to-protect-musicians-artists-and-creators-from-unauthorized-ai-training/) and NO FAKES Act (https://www.blackburn.senate.gov/2025/4/technology/blackburn-coons-salazar-dean-colleagues-introduce-no-fakes-act-to-protect-individuals-and-creators-from-digital-replicas).
